CITGO PETROLEUM CORPORATION
CITGO Petroleum Corporation is a recognized leader in the refining industry and operates under the well-known CITGO brand. CITGO owns and operates three refineries located in Lake Charles, LA.; Lemont, IL.; and Corpus Christi, TX, and wholly and/or jointly owns 38 active terminals, six pipelines and three lubricants blending and packaging plants. With approximately 3,300 employees and a combined crude capacity of approximately 807,000 barrels-per-day (bpd), positions CITGO as one of the best-branded supplier companies in the industry.

Job Summary
Environmental Advisor-Air position will be responsible for several air compliance programs, including Leak Detection and Repair (LDAR), Cooling Towers (CT), Benzene Fenceline Monitoring (Bz FLM), Ozone Depleting Substances (ODS), Reciprocating Internal Combustion Engines (RICE), and Tanks (Kc LEL monitoring). Advisor will also be responsible for data evaluations, periodic reporting, supporting refinery personnel on compliance matters related to LDAR, Bz FLM, etc., and participate in on-call duty rotation for spills and agency notifications. The position requires the ability to prepare agency correspondence, utilize Microsoft programs to manage compliance tools, effectively communicate to refinery and contract personnel, maintain program guidance documents current, train refinery and contract personnel, coordinate with refinery and contract personnel on LDAR leaks, Delay of Repair, CT leaks, leaks affecting Bz FLM performance, Internal Floating Roof Tank LEL monitoring, and prepare semi-annual and annual compliance reports. The air advisor must also ensure Refinery adheres to federal and state regulations and permit requirements, in addition to attending refinery meetings to represent environmental for air compliance requirements and completing management of change (MOC) Env checklist when requested by the Area MOC Manager.
Minimum Qualifications
- Bachelor’s degree in Engineering, Science, Environmental or related technical field plus 3 years of job-related experience
- Must have strong verbal and written communication skills.
- Must have strong computer skills, including proficiency with Microsoft Office programs.
Job Duties
- Manage and gather required data for preparing periodic compliance reports, including Plant Manager certification (review/signing) and submittal to regulatory agency. Periodic reports include quarterly MACT CC Fenceline Monitoring, semi-annual NSPS VVa/MACT CC & HON MACT Subpart H LDAR (fugitive) reports.
- Manage and gather required data for preparing and submitting reportable quantity (RQ) incident notifications for air emissions and spills during on-call duty. Reports to be reviewed by Supervisor, Environmental Manager (or delegate), and HSSE Manager.
- Schedule, monitor, and manage contractor conducting LDAR monitoring (valves, pumps, etc.). Ensure Delay of Repair requests meet requirements before approving. Ensure monthly Cooling Tower water is monitored for volatile organic compound (VOC) leakage from heat exchangers. Maintain records for ODS and RICE inventory and schedule engine stack testing as applicable.
- Utilize industry compliance tools to improve data gathering and compliance reporting and minimize manual data entry and tracking.
- Maintain and improve compliance program processes, guidance documents, and procedures. Periodically train refinery personnel. Ensure Turnaround Environmental Plans are updated with current compliance/permit requirements.
- Maintain regulatory knowledge of current areas of responsibilities. Provide support to refinery personnel and become point of contact for assigned Refinery Area.
